Knocknacarra (Clybaun Hotel) Test Centre | Route Profile

A temporary relocation for the Westside center in Galway City. It operates from the Clybaun Hotel, testing drivers on the hilly residential terrain of Knocknacarra. Base location: The Clybaun Hotel, Clybaun Road, Knocknacarra, H91 F62V.

#1 Fail Reason The top reason for failure is poor positioning at the tight junctions along the Clybaun Road and the surrounding residential streets. Many candidates also fail for inadequate observation at the local roundabouts during heavy traffic. Track these zones in the app →
Red Zone: The 3:00 PM school pick-up hour is the absolute worst time for this centre due to the density of schools in the immediate vicinity. Saturday lunchtimes are also hectic as shoppers flock to the nearby retail centres.

Local Hazards

The hills in the Knocknacarra area make for challenging hill starts and reverse maneuvers. Many mini-roundabouts in residential estates require quick decision-making and clear signaling.

Community Advice

The residential roundabouts in Knocknacarra can be frequent; ensure you signal correctly for every exit. Watch for school zone speed limits if your test falls during school hours.

Arrival & Parking Protocol

Tip: The testing site is based at the Clybaun Hotel with parking available in the main hotel lot. Candidates should look for the RSA meeting point and park in a way that allows for easy exit into the busy suburban traffic of Knocknacarra.
